Abstract: |
An archaeological watching was carried out by Terrain Archaeology during the groundworks for a new extension at St Nicholas' Church, Winterborne Clenston in July 2018. The observations revealed part of the foundations of the existing 1840 church. A grave of an adult coffined burial of eighteenth/nineteenth century date, which is likely to pre-date the present church was also found. It was cut by a brick and stone lined drain associated with the present church. Another feature of unknown form, date and function was also found, pre-dating the burial. |
